The Unversity of Ottawa is pleased to invite qualified proponents to submit a proposal for a laser that will be used for driving two optical parametric amplifiers (OPA). The OPA outputs serve as seed pulses for a high-power mid-infared laser system.The laser needs to produce two outputs at the same time. Each channel is to deliver no less than 2 mJ, pulses shorter than 250 fs, at 5 kHz. The carrier-envelope phase of the pulses from at least one of the channels must be stabliized.Mandatory Requirements:1. Yb CPA Laser1.1 Pulse Duration full width at half maximum (FWHM) must be: 100 fs ≤ t ≤ 250 fs.1.2 Central Wavelength λc must = 1030 ± 50nm.1.3 Pulse Energy (Single Shot to 5 kHz) must be either two channels where E ≥ 2 mJ for each channel, or one channel where E ≥ 4 mJ1.4 The laser must be capable of achieving two outputs simultaneously.1.5 Repetition rate must be: 1 Hz ≤ frep ≤ 50 kHz. 1.6 Power stability must be 1.7 Output beam quality must be M2 1.8 Polarization must be Linear1.9 Power must be either 120 VAC or 208 VAC, single phase, 1.10 Pulse selection: any base repetition rate division (the repetition rate can be the maximum value divided by any power of 2; such as 2, 4, 8, etc.)1.11 The carrier-envelope phase of the pulses from a minimum of one channel must be stabilized.
